Almost certainly a yellow form of Crocosmia. Which cultivar it may be is
anybody's guess: there are quite a number of yellow crocosmia cultivars, and I
suspect they're badly mixed up in the trade.
Or has Wisley conducted a trial of "yellow crocosmias" and published a key that
distinguished the cultivars?
